Buses in Croydon that carry children with special educational needs and disabilities have been fitted with tablets to improve their journey.

Croydon Council operates 39 SEND buses to five schools with some bus journeys lasting up to two hours.

The roll out came after a pilot last term which found them to be beneficial, along with positive feedback from parents.

The screens have now been fitted in 20 buses and will play educational videos as well as Makaton to help with communication.
